
Iberdrola Completes Monopile Installation at Windanker Offshore Wind Farm in Germany
Iberdrola Deutschland, the German branch of global energy giant Iberdrola, has achieved a significant milestone in the development of the Windanker offshore wind farm, with the successful installation of all 21 monopile foundations. This achievement marks the beginning of the next phase of the project, bringing the wind farm closer to its operational target and reinforcing Iberdrola’s commitment to expanding renewable energy infrastructure in the Baltic Sea region.
The 21 monopile foundations, which form the structural backbone of the wind turbines, were manufactured at a specialized production facility in Spain. This plant is equipped with advanced technology specifically designed for large monopile foundations. The production of these critical components was made possible through a strategic partnership between Navantia Seanergies, a major player in naval engineering, and Windar Renovables, a leading company in renewable energy structures. The collaboration leverages their combined expertise to deliver robust and high-quality foundations capable of withstanding the challenging conditions of the Baltic Sea.
The installation process was carried out by the Dutch marine contractor Van Oord, utilizing the heavy-lift installation vessel Svanen. This vessel is specifically designed for offshore construction projects of this magnitude, enabling precise placement of the monopiles at the designated positions in the seabed. The Windanker offshore wind farm is expected to become operational by the end of 2026, as scheduled. Once fully commissioned, the project will play a crucial role in providing clean and renewable energy to Germany, contributing to the country’s transition away from fossil fuels and toward a more sustainable energy system. The wind farm’s location in the Baltic Sea allows it to harness consistent and strong wind resources, making it a highly efficient source of renewable electricity.
Windanker is part of the larger Baltic Hub initiative, which also includes the existing Wikinger and Baltic Eagle offshore wind farms. Together, these three projects will increase Iberdrola’s installed offshore capacity in the Baltic Sea to over 1,100 megawatts (MW). This expansion represents a substantial step toward achieving regional energy security while supporting Germany’s climate and renewable energy targets. The combined output of the Baltic Hub will be sufficient to power more than 1.1 million households annually, highlighting the project’s significant contribution to decarbonizing the power sector.
The development of Windanker also reflects Iberdrola’s commitment to international collaboration in the renewable energy sector. Since December 2024, Japanese energy company Kansai has held a 49% stake in the Windanker project, with Iberdrola retaining a majority 51% stake.
